Adorable Family Care Home in Raleigh is best suited for families seeking a warm, home-like assisted living option where care feels personal and highly attentive. It works well for seniors who need dementia or memory-support services, as well as those who may eventually require hospice-level assistance but still want care delivered in a familiar, intimate setting. The strongest fit is for families who value a hands-on, relationship-driven approach: caregivers who show up reliably, coordinate well with relatives, and adapt quickly to shifting needs without turning care into a bureaucratic process.
Those who may want to consider alternatives are families prioritizing a highly structured, campus-style environment with rigid schedules and formal facility protocols. If a guaranteed, 24/7 predictable routine is non-negotiable, or if a larger, more impersonal operation with standardized processes is preferred, other options may suit better. Overnight care and strictly defined service windows can be a concern for some, as one review documented a mismatch between expectations and scheduling practices. In such cases, a traditional assisted living facility or a larger home-care agency with explicit SLAs may offer greater predictability.

The main drawbacks center on occasional administrative frictions. A minority of reviews describe unwelcoming office interactions and a lack of proactive communication about cancellations, which can feel destabilizing in time-sensitive care arrangements. These concerns are not universal, but they matter: a slip in scheduling or a chilly administrative tone can ripple through a family's planning efforts. The strongest defense against these risks is to insist on a clear, written care plan with a single point of contact, and to verify tripwires for changes in staffing well in advance.
For decisions, approach this community with a practical checklist: request a face-to-face meeting with the leadership team to understand caregiver-matching practices and the process for substitutions when regular caregivers are unavailable; ask for a written, month-by-month care schedule; confirm overnight or extended hours options and any associated costs; require references from families with similar needs (especially dementia or hospice care); and arrange a short trial period to observe how the team communicates and coordinates with family members. A transparent billing and scheduling policy should be as non-negotiable as compassionate care.

The Adorable Family Care Home in Raleigh, NC offers a warm and inviting environment for seniors in need of board and care services. The fully furnished home provides a comfortable and cozy setting for residents to feel at ease.
With a spacious dining room, residents can enjoy nutritious and delicious meals prepared by the dedicated staff. Special dietary restrictions are taken into consideration to ensure each resident's unique needs are met.
The community features a beautiful garden and outdoor space, allowing residents to enjoy fresh air and a serene atmosphere. Housekeeping services are provided to maintain cleanliness and tidiness throughout the home.
Residents can stay connected with loved ones through the telephone and Wi-Fi/high-speed internet available in the community. Additionally, transportation arrangements are made for medical appointments, ensuring easy access to healthcare providers when needed.
At Adorable Family Care Home, residents receive ass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. Medication management is also provided to ensure proper administration of medications. The staff coordinates with health care providers to ensure comprehensive care for each resident.
Scheduled daily activities keep residents engaged and entertained. Assisted Living and Memory Care: Understanding Their Core Differences
Assisted living provides moderate support for seniors seeking independence, while memory care offers specialized support for individuals with dementia or cognitive impairments through structured routines and trained staff. Key differences include care approaches, environment security measures, staff training levels, activity types, and cost considerations.
